He was the youngest child of Samuel and Hannah Leighton. Out of a family of nine children four survive him. He was first married to Minnie Richard of Plainwell, who died March 27, 1898 and to this union four children were born. Fred, who lived to be 16 months old; Natalie, now living in Shelbyville; Ruth, lately deceased, and William of this city. His second marriage was to Mrs. Cora Cooley. Three children were born to them, Mildred, who died at the age of six. Four years ago his health started on the decline and since he has suffered almost constantly. He was very patient although anxious to recover. Deceased was an honest, hardworking man and square in his dealings; a devoted husband an father. He lived the greater part of his life in this vicinity and was highly respected. He leaves to mourn besides his immediate family a host of relatives and friends. He was a member of the I.O.O.F. and that order conducted the burial service at Mountain Home Cemetery. The discourse was delivered by Rev.T.H. Carey Paster of the Baptist Church.
